Title: Martin Widmaier: Innovator in Marine Surveying Technology
Introduction
Martin Widmaier is a prominent inventor based in Oslo, Norway. He has made significant contributions to the field of marine surveying, holding a total of 6 patents. His innovative approaches have advanced the methods used in underwater exploration and data acquisition.
Latest Patents
Widmaier's latest patents include groundbreaking technologies such as "Surveying with non-uniform survey configuration with wide-tow source geometry." This patent describes a method and apparatus for marine surveying that involves towing sources in a wide-tow source geometry and utilizing streamers that comprise receivers. The system allows for the creation of a signal that is detected by a first receiver, ensuring a regular sampling grid for the survey area. Another notable patent is "Hybrid ocean bottom seismic receiver and streamer seismic data acquisition using wide towed sources." This invention outlines methods for performing marine surveys of subterranean formations using a combination of ocean bottom seismic receivers and wide towed sources, enhancing the efficiency and accuracy of seismic data collection.
